342 bodies of martyrs recovered from mass grave in Nasser Complex

The number of martyrs whose bodies have been recovered so far from the mass grave at the Nasser Medical Complex in Khan Yunis, in the southern Gaza Strip, has reached 342, according to the Civil Defense in Gaza today.

According to the Palestinian Ma’an news agency, several mass graves were discovered after the withdrawal of enemy forces from Nasser and Shifa hospitals.

It is noteworthy that the head of the media office in Gaza, Salameh Maarouf, said in a statement last Monday, that “the fate of about 2,000 citizens who were present at the Nasser Medical Complex when it was stormed by the occupation army is still unknown and it is not known if they were arrested or killed and their bodies hidden.”

Maarouf added: “Today, the bodies of 73 martyrs were recovered, bringing the total number of bodies recovered since last Friday to 283 martyrs.”
